Calculating outs (how many cards that could improve your hand) and pot odds (ratio of the money in the pot versus the total amount needed to make your next call) is usually used as a basis for a Texas Hold Em Poker person on whether to draw and try to make their hand.

But this I think should not function as sole foundation of your decision on whether you should draw for another card.

You also have to decide on if the hand that you are wanting to reach will get you the pot or not.

Just how to calculate container odds:

In this example, if the current pot includes $80, and the total amount required at the following call is $20, the pot is putting you odds of $80 to $20 or 4 to 1.

So long as your likelihood of making the best hand are 4 to at least one or better than making the contact is the right move. A hand that is 4 to 1 means that you will strike once in every 5 tries. You'll strike the draw 20 per cent of the time.

This next example considers determining pot odds and outs.

Assume that the hole cards are a six and an eight (for this example matches do not matter) and the flop came down 8-9-3.

In order to complete your hand you need a 5 or 10. You've eight outs 4-5s and 4-10s. Flourish your outs (8) by you and 4 get 32. You've a 32 per cent chance of making your hand. You would multiply by two if there clearly was just one card left to bring.

A 32 percent chance of making your hand means you've a percent chance of MAYBE not making your hand. This really is about 2 to 1 that you wont make the hand. Therefore, as long since the container contains $2 for every single $1 that you have to call, it's worth going after your straight.

Doing these quick calculations and interpreting them can be confusing and very difficult for a novice (and many sophisticated participants as well!). But I would suggest that you at least be able to quickly assess your outs to give an idea to you of just how likely you're to produce your hand.
